What’s a Rotary Sensor?

At its core, a rotary position sensor measures angle of movement—how far something has turned, and in which direction. Basic, but extremely important. Think of it like the machine’s sense of direction. It sends signals to let the system know what’s moving and how much. 

But there’s one thing, machines don’t always operate in clean, dry, air-conditioned spaces. They’re out in fields, on factory floors, in rains, dust, grease, and sometimes worse. That’s why IP67 matters. The “IP” stands for Ingress Protection, and the “67” rating means the sensor is completely dustproof and can withstand brief immersion in water. It’s tough enough for the real world. 

Some are even non-contact, meaning they don’t rely on physical contact between parts to measure movement. That matters because it means less wear and tear and a significantly longer life.

Where do these sensors actually get used?

You’d be surprised at how many places rotary sensors are used. Once you start looking, they’re everywhere. 

  1. Robotics

Robots need to know the exact location of every joint, wheel, and arm at all times. A non-contact rotary sensor helps them move smoothly and accurately. These sensors ensure that a robotic arm picks up an object from the correct spot and places it down exactly where it should be. And because there’s no fiction, they last a long time without needing much maintenance. 

  1. Heavy Equipment (Farming, Construction)

If you’ve got a  machine working in the mud, hauling heavy loads, or digging trenches, you need something that won’t quit when the weather turns bad. A durable rotary sensor helps control everything from bucket angles to steering systems. And it continues to do its job even when things get messy. 

  1. Factory Equipment

Factories run non-stop, and timing is everything. Packaging lines, robotic arms, and conveyor systems all rely on sensors to keep things moving just right. A rotary position sensor with both analog and digital outputs fits seamlessly into modern automation systems—and thanks to its rugged design, it remains unaffected by dust, oil, or vibrations.
